Congress Tightens Grip on Jawalamukhi Municipal Council; Som Kiran Sharma Elected President, Deepti Sood Vice-President

Jawalamukhi, June 16: The Congress party has further strengthened its position in the Jawalamukhi Municipal Council after Som Kiran Sharma was unanimously elected President and Deepti Sood as Vice-President on Tuesday. The unopposed election of both office-bearers is being seen as a reflection of the party's unity and its commanding majority in the civic body.

The development follows the Congress party’s impressive performance in the recently concluded municipal elections, where it secured seven of the nine seats in the council. The unanimous election of party-backed candidates to the top posts is being viewed as a significant political achievement for the Congress in the region.

Political observers have credited local MLA Sanjay Rattan for the party’s success. Under his leadership, the Congress strengthened its organizational network across wards and effectively mobilized public support during the election campaign. The latest victory is seen as further evidence of the party’s growing influence in Jawalamukhi.

Congress leader Gyaneshwar Sharma described the outcome as a clear endorsement of the party’s policies and leadership. He said the people of Jawalamukhi had reaffirmed their faith in Congress despite a strong challenge from the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P), giving the party a decisive mandate for local governance.

Local leaders noted that the elected Congress councillors demonstrated remarkable coordination and unity, resulting in a consensus on both leadership positions and eliminating the need for a contest.

With the formation of the new council leadership, expectations have risen for accelerated development initiatives, improved sanitation, stronger civic infrastructure, enhanced public services, and effective resolution of local issues.

Expressing gratitude after her election, newly elected President Som Kiran Sharma thanked the people of Jawalamukhi, MLA Sanjay Rattan, and fellow councillors for placing their trust in her.

“I sincerely thank Hon’ble MLA Shri Sanjay Rattan Ji, all councillors, and the respected citizens of Jawalamukhi for entrusting me with this responsibility. This opportunity to serve the people is a matter of great honor, and I will strive to fulfill it with dedication, transparency, and commitment,” she said.

She further stated that under the guidance of MLA Sanjay Rattan and with the support of all elected representatives and citizens, the Municipal Council would work towards writing a new chapter of development, transparency, and cleanliness in Jawalamukhi.

Calling for collective participation, Som Kiran Sharma urged residents to join hands in building a stronger, cleaner, and more developed Jawalamukhi for future generations.
